A dental expert is a dentist is a dental expert? Well, not quite. For routine tests, cleanings, and the occasional dental filling, many people see a basic dental expert. Occasionally our smiles need more than common treatment. In this case, there are several kinds of oral professionals, each with a particular role websites to fill up for your dental treatment.


As a result of genetics, concerns with your total health, an accident, or some other reason, you may need to visit a dental specialist. Here are the six different kinds of dental specialists you could see throughout a life time of dental treatment: If your tooth's pulp comes to be contaminated or the interior of your teeth becomes or else damaged or unhealthy, your general dental professional will most likely refer you to a dental specialist called an.


Inside our teeth are tiny cavern-like passages called canals which contain delicate pulp, capillary, and nerves. An endodontist is a kind of dental expert who diagnoses and treats troubles within this delicate interior. Endodontists diagnose tooth discomfort and, in most cases, do root canals on diseased teeth.
